Latest Patents
Among her latest inventions, the "Flexible Joint Wrap" stands out. This innovative joint wrap features a heat exchange bladder that facilitates fluid circulation and compression around a joint. The design includes upper and lower sections for securing the wrap above and below the joint. Notably, the bladder has a central opening, providing flexibility, and is enclosed in a removable cover tailored to the bladder's shape. This inventive cover is constructed with a fluid-repellent inner lining to keep the bladder clean, while the nylon loop outer surface allows for easy attachment and adjustment.
